Grandpa's Bow Tie

I had a "really-missing-my-dad" week last week. I just missed him. Between that, being a temporary single parent and a nasty cold and sore throat, I was pretty grumpy. But yesterday, Sam came out of his room ready for church wearing this.

My dad never wore it that I remember. It was probably a gift from a patient who knew he liked fly-fishing. But when we came across it while going through my dad's things after the funeral, I immediately thought of my Sam who since his Halloween stint as a magician has had a thing for bow ties. I never expected to see him actually wear it. But yesterday he did, with a smile on his face and a tear in his eye.

I imagine my dad was smiling, too.
